错转代币的警钟:从智能合约到用户权限的全面防守

tp钱包的代币误转事件并非孤立事故,而是暴露了行业在背后并不算暗黑的结构性缺陷。一次点击的失误涉及前端设计、合约逻辑、以及用户教育等多层次因素。当前的区块链生态里,转账一旦在链上被确认,几乎没有“撤回”这一说法。钱包厂商若仅靠UI的提醒,难以真正消弭风险。要解决这个问题,必须在智能合约的设计、用户权限体系、前端防护到数据治理等环节,形成一个连贯的安全网。

在智能合约层面,若要为误转提供可能的补救路径,须探索设计上的可回滚、可冻结或可分离授权的模式。比如对大额转出设定多签、二次确认、时间锁,甚至在合约层面允许在特定条件下冻结 token 以便救助。任何“可逆转”的机制都要兼顾去中心化的不可变性与滥用风险,并需要公开的治理流程和紧急冻结权限的严格审计。

用户权限方面,应坚持最小权限原则。热钱包的操作权限应与冷钱包隔离,关键操作如大额转出需多要素签名、设备绑定、以及离线助记词的保管。钱包界面应清晰区分“拟执行的操作”和“已签署的授权”,避免模糊的二次确认诱导。

防XSS攻击则是前端与DApp交互中的另一道防线。钱包应对外部网站的输入进行严格验证,禁用不受信任的脚本访问秘钥容器,采用内容安全策略(CSP)和严格的域白名单。同时,离线签名与热/冷路径分离的架构,可以降低恶意站点对签名流程的干扰风险。

数据管理方面,创新并非绕开隐私,而是通过可追溯的审计链路提升信任。例如对所有交易事件建立不可篡改的本地哈希表、对导出合约的行为进行版本化跟踪、并在不暴露隐私的前提下提供安全可核验的记录。

合约导入环节需要额外的审慎。导入外部合约前,应进行代码指纹比对、静态审计与签名验证,建立可信白名单与版本锁定机制。引入“导入即审计”的门槛,可以让用户在对照已知风险时做出知情选择。

专家研判是破题的关键。不应让任何单点责任人承受全部压力,而是组建跨领域应急小组,制定事件响应流程、信息披露守则,以及对受影响用户的救济方案。只有把技术、合规与教育统一纳入治理框架,才能让信任在社会层级的生态里重新扎根。

结论不在于否定区块链技术的价值,而在于把风险提前设计进系统。管理员、开发者与用户要共同承担前瞻性的责任:在操作前设立多重护栏,在遇到错转时具备快速、透明的应对路径。只https://www.z7779.com ,有建立可验证的结构性安全,才有可能让错转不再成为市场的集体创伤。

作者:风隐者发布时间:2025-10-04 12:21:58

评论

CryptoNova

文中关于可回滚与时间锁的讨论很有启发。现实中是否已有成功案例应用了这样的模式?若没有,是否会引入新的治理成本与滥用风险?

星云守卫

合约导入前的指纹比对与签名验证是关键,建议将白名单机制写入钱包核心逻辑,并提供清晰的版本控制和回滚日志。

MangoCoder

对XSS防护的强调很到位。除了CSP,还应考虑输入隔离、域名分离以及离线签名流程的严格封装,避免用户在不信任的DApp环境中泄露私钥。

LedgerKnight

专家研判不可或缺,但需建立跨机构的治理框架与行业标准,避免单一厂商承担所有风险。应讨论应急资金、用户救济与信息公开的平衡。

币匠不眠

用户教育也是防线之一。应加强备份、启用双因素、设置交易提醒与分级授权,让误转发生前后都能有更清晰的行动指南。

相关阅读